Full List of Elected Kampala Division and Wakiso Municipality Mayors

By Kabuye Ronald

Following the conclusion of the Local Council elections for City Division and Municipality Mayors across the country, Trusted News Uganda has compiled a comprehensive list of candidates who emerged victorious in Kampala Capital City Authority (KCCA) and Wakiso District, along with their respective political parties.

In Kampala, voters delivered a mixed political outcome across the five city divisions. Salim Saad Uhuru of the National Resistance Movement (NRM) was elected Mayor of Kampala Central Division. Nakawa Division was won by National Unity Platform (NUP) candidate Ali Buken, popularly known as Nubian Li, while Dr. Emmanuel Sserunjoji, also of NUP, secured victory in Kawempe Division. Lubaga Division was taken by NUP’s Mberaze Mawula Zacchy.

Makindye Division saw NRM’s Yasin Omar declared winner unopposed after the Electoral Commission disqualified 11 other aspirants for failing to meet the required number of supporting signatures.

In Wakiso District, the four municipality mayoral races were largely dominated by the NRM, with one key opposition win. Fabrice Rulinda (NRM) emerged victorious in Entebbe Municipality, Allan Bulamu (NRM) clinched the Kira Municipality seat, and Bosco Galabuzi (NRM) won in Makindye Ssabagabo Municipality. Nansana Municipality was taken by National Unity Platform’s John Bosco Sserunkuma, popularly known as Kaana Ka Mbaata.

The results reflect continued political competition between the ruling NRM and the opposition NUP in the Kampala metropolitan area, setting the stage for closely watched leadership dynamics at both city and municipal levels in the coming term.
